Comprehending Common Patio Door Lock Issues
Patio door locks, while created for security, are prone to use and tear over time due to regular use and direct exposure to the aspects. Several typical issues can necessitate patio door lock repair. Identifying these problems can help you comprehend the seriousness and kind of service you may need.
Common Patio Door Lock Problems:
Sticky or Jammed Locks: This is a frequent problem frequently caused by dirt, debris, or rust accumulation within the lock system. Sometimes, it's due to misaligned doors causing friction, preventing the bolt from efficiently engaging.Broken or Damaged Locking Mechanisms: Internal elements of the lock can break due to age, wear, or tried break-in. This might involve damaged locks, cylinders, or other internal parts that are essential for the lock's function.Loose or Wobbly Handles and Hardware: Over time, screws can loosen, triggering deals with and locking hardware to end up being wobbly or separated. This not only feels insecure but can likewise affect the lock's correct functioning.Stripped Screws or Damaged Frames: Attempting DIY repairs or forceful operation can sometimes damage the screw holes in the door frame or door itself, making it hard to firmly reattach the lock.Key Issues: Keys may become bent, damaged, or lost, or the lock cylinder itself may end up being broken, making it challenging to place or turn the secret.Misalignment Problems: Settling foundations, changing temperature levels, or wear and tear on rollers and tracks can cause Patio Door Repairs doors to misalign. Confronted with a faulty patio door lock, property owners may consider a DIY repair technique to conserve expenses. While some minor issues may be tackled with fundamental tools and a little know-how, more complicated problems are best delegated professionals.
When DIY Might Be Possible (and When It's Not):
Simple Tightening: Loose screws on deals with or hardware can typically be tightened up with a screwdriver. This is a simple DIY repair.Lubrication: Sticky locks due to dirt and particles can often be fixed with a silicone-based lube. Using lube into the keyhole and moving parts can in some cases free up a jammed mechanism.Basic Cylinder Replacement (If Experienced): If you are comfortable with basic locksmithing principles and have previous experience, you may be able to replace a basic cylinder if you have the appropriate replacement part.
